Now for the song “Where Were You When I Needed You” by the Grassroots was on their debut studio album in 1966. The song was actually written for the Hermans Hermits and their movie Hold On! They chose to use different song so it was picked up by the Grassroots. Have you ever asked someone Where were you when I needed you? How many of you know this song? Who likes the Grassroots?
The Grass Roots is an American rock band that charted between 1966 and 1975. It was originally the creation of Lou Adler and songwriting duo P. F. Sloan and ...
